Mission

The mission of the Department of Religious Education (DRE) is to connect you to Christ, His Church, and his grace. By serving the local, metropolis/district, and national levels of the Greek Orthodox Archdiocese of America through resources, programs, services, and publications to advance religious education — for all ages.

The DRE is more than traditional education, more than books, more than online shopping, more than competitions. We exist to guide people in how to practically live Orthodoxy day-to-day instead of just being able to talk about it theoretically. That is what our DRE Team are humbly and prayerfully working on so you can “grow in the grace and knowledge of our Lord and Savior Jesus Christ” (2 Peter 3:18).

    Religious Education Curriculum

    From preschool through high school, students encounter the saints, scriptures, sacraments, doctrines and traditions of Orthodox Christianity through our curriculum. Browse and download our Curriculum Catalog and Recommended Texts for Sunday Church Schools for more information.

    Sermon Series

    Easy-to-download sermons for clergy and educators based on the upcoming Sunday Gospels. Every week a new sermon will be released for each Sunday of the ecclesiastical year. The Series includes both the Gospel readings and insights and explanations about them.

    Did You Know?

    DID YOU KNOW? is your go-to source for concise answers to a wide range of questions about the Greek Orthodox faith. Each answer packs a punch of insight in 200 words or less. DYK? equips Gen Z and millennials with facts they can trust and easily absorb while scrolling. Clergy, religious educators, and parents can share these nuggets of knowledge with the faithful, students, those inquiring about Orthodoxy, and loved ones.

    Vacation Church School

    The Twelve Great Feasts VCS currriculum is a comprehensive five-session, half-day program for children ages 5–11 (kindergarten to 5th grade). The authors also provide suggestions for adapting VCS to a parish’s needs, such as alternative schedules and age groupings.
